#2992d2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2992d2 is composed of 16.1% red, 57.3% green and 82.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 80.5% cyan, 30.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 17.6% black. It has a hue angle of 202.7 degrees, a saturation of 67.3% and a lightness of 49.2%. #2992d2 color hex could be obtained by blending #52ffff with #0025a5. Closest websafe color is: #3399cc.

#2992d2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2992d2 has RGB values of R:41, G:146, B:210 and CMYK values of C:0.8, M:0.3, Y:0,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 2724562.

Shades and Tints of #2992d2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#03090d is the darkest color, while #fcfdfe is the lightest one.
